Do mini cribs need different mattresses?

Yes, mini cribs require mattresses that are specially designed for them. Mini cribs typically have an exact mattress size requirement of 38” x 24” and regular adult mattresses, even those labeled as “portable crib” sizes will not fit properly in the mini crib. Regular mattresses will be too large and can create dangerous gaps or pose suffocation risks if babies roll over onto the side of the mattress which sticks out from the edge of the frame.

The best type of mattress for a mini crib is one specifically made for a mini crib. Typically these are constructed with polyurethane foam and have cotton or polyester covers that keep dust mites away while remaining breathable enough to help prevent overheating. What Size Mattress Goes In A Mini Crib?

Mini cribs are a great option for smaller spaces, such as apartments, dorm rooms, or small bedrooms. But the most important factor when selecting a mini crib is making sure you get the right mattress size – because good sleep starts with the right mattress!

The ideal size of a mini crib mattress should be 38” x 24” and no thicker than four inches. A full-sized sheet should fit perfectly on top of it. Anything bigger might not be safe and could increase the risk of suffocation due to poor air circulation in the mattress itself. You may find some mini mattresses that are slightly larger or thicker, but make sure to check with your specific manufacturer before purchasing them as they could still put your baby at risk for injury.

When looking for a proper mini crib mattress, make sure to look out for materials listed by CertiPUR-US®, which indicate it has been tested and certified by an independent third-party laboratory according to established standards from organizations like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) and U.S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). It also means that all foam used in their products is made without any ozone depleters like PBDE flame retardants, mercury, lead, or other heavy metals; formaldehyde; phthalates regulated by CPSC; CFCs; HCFCs; TDCPP/TDCPP; or TCEP (tris), which have all been linked to health problems like asthma attacks and certain types of cancer over time. What is the Difference Between Mini Crib Mattress Vs Full-Size Mattress?

One of the main differences between a mini crib mattress and a full-size mattress is size. A mini crib mattress measures 38” x 24” in size, while a full-size mattress generally ranges from 52” x 28” up to 60” x 80” depending on the bed frame. Mini crib mattresses are also typically four inches thick, whereas most full-sized mattresses can range from 8 to 12 inches thick.

Another difference between these two types of mattresses is construction materials. Full-sized mattresses tend to feature coils or innerspring for support that makes them more durable, whereas mini cribs are usually foam based with a cotton or polyester cover.
